An important consideration in fully understanding and appreciating a work of art is the context in which the work was created. I believe the artist/painter's  life experiences outside his/her respective painting studio  and the time and location where its creation took place is vital information to fully appreciate a work of art. Therefore, art that impresses me ...that resonates or appeals to my aesthetic senses is art that arouses sympathy for the creator of the work. In other words, it is art that reflects the artist's  life and his immediate environment.  It is art with content..a human narrative..replete with human pathos that draws me to consider the work. The other stuff such as line, color, shape, etc follows in relevance.
